Personal data Berdina Maria Kouwenberg 

  • She was born on August 26, 1905 in Goirle.
  • She died on September 16, 1961 in Tilburg, she was 56 years old.

Household of Berdina Maria Kouwenberg

She is married to Gerardus Wilhelmus Cornelis Horvers.

They got married on May 9, 1938 at Goirle, she was 32 years old.
